The Impact Of Room Size On Optimal Tv Screen Size

When choosing the optimal TV screen size, it’s essential to consider the impact of the room size on your viewing experience. A 55-inch 4K TV may be suitable for a medium-sized room, but in a larger space, the screen size might not provide an immersive viewing experience. A general rule of thumb for optimal viewing distance is that it should be 1.5 to 2.5 times the diagonal size of your TV. For a 55-inch TV, the ideal viewing distance is typically between 6.9 to 11.5 feet.

Additionally, the layout of your room plays a crucial role in determining the optimal TV screen size. If the seating arrangements are spread across a wide area, a larger screen size may be necessary to ensure all viewers have a comfortable viewing experience. Conversely, in a more compact room, a 55-inch TV might offer a more intimate and engaging experience. Ultimately, the perfect TV size for your room depends on the viewing distance and the layout of the space, ensuring an enjoyable and immersive viewing experience for all.

Future-Proofing Your Purchase: Will 55 Inches Remain Adequate?

As technology continues to advance, it’s natural to wonder if a 55-inch 4K TV will remain adequate in the future. With 8K TVs on the horizon and the increasing availability of high-resolution content, many consumers are concerned about future-proofing their TV purchases. However, it’s important to consider that the average viewing distance in most living rooms may not require larger screen sizes for optimal viewing. A 55-inch TV can still provide an immersive experience when placed at an appropriate distance from the viewer.

It’s also worth noting that the availability of 8K content is still limited, and it may take some time for it to become mainstream. Additionally, the pricing of 8K TVs and the resources required to support them, such as high-speed internet and compatible devices, may serve as barriers for widespread adoption in the near future. While technological advancements are inevitable, a 55-inch 4K TV can still satisfy most consumers’ viewing needs for the foreseeable future, especially when considering budget constraints and practical viewing distances. Therefore, despite the ever-evolving technology landscape, a 55-inch 4K TV remains a solid choice for many consumers looking to invest in a high-quality viewing experience.
